What to Look for in a Refurbished Monitor? 

Not all monitors are created equal—and the same goes for refurbished ones. Here’s what you should keep in mind: 

  • Resolution: For work, 1080p is great, but creatives and gamers may prefer 1440p or 4K. 
  • Refresh Rate: Gamers, look for 120Hz or higher. For work, 60Hz is usually enough. 
  • Panel Type: IPS panels offer better colour accuracy and viewing angles; TN panels are faster but lower quality visually. 
  • Connectivity: Make sure it has the right ports—HDMI, DisplayPort, USB-C, etc.

Choosing the Right Refurbished Monitor: Work vs. Gaming 

Feature Work Gaming 
Screen Size 24-inch to 32-inch (depending on desk space and multitasking needs) 24-inch to 32-inch (competitive gaming often favors 24-27 inch, immersive gaming benefits from larger) 
Resolution 1920×1080 (FHD) minimum, 2560×1440 (QHD) recommended for detail 1920×1080 (FHD) is common, 2560×1440 (QHD) offers a good balance, 3840×2160 (4K) can be great for visually stunning single-player games if your GPU can handle it 
Refresh Rate 60Hz is sufficient for most productivity tasks 144Hz or higher is highly recommended for smoother motion and a competitive edge. 75Hz can be a budget-friendly step up. 
Response Time 5ms to 8ms is generally acceptable for work 1ms to 4ms is preferred for minimal motion blur in fast-paced games. 
Panel Type IPS for accurate color reproduction and wide viewing angles (important for design, media editing). VA is a good middle ground. TN is generally less preferred for color accuracy. TN for fastest response times (competitive gaming). IPS offers better color and viewing angles with good response times now. VA provides good contrast. 
Aspect Ratio 16:9 is standard. Ultrawide (21:9 or 32:9) can boost productivity. 16:9 is standard. Ultrawide can offer a more immersive gaming experience. 
Ergonomics Adjustable stand (height, tilt, swivel, pivot) is highly beneficial for comfortable long work sessions. Adjustability is helpful for comfort during long gaming sessions. VESA mount can be useful for setup flexibility. 
Connectivity HDMI, DisplayPort (ensure compatibility with your work laptop/desktop), USB ports can be useful for peripherals. HDMI, DisplayPort (ensure compatibility with your gaming PC), consider the version for higher bandwidth (e.g., HDMI 2.0/2.1, DP 1.4). 
Adaptive Sync Not typically a critical factor for work. AMD FreeSync or NVIDIA G-Sync compatibility to eliminate screen tearing and stuttering. Check your graphics card compatibility. 
Built-in Speakers Can be convenient for basic audio but external speakers or headphones are usually preferred. Dedicated headsets or speakers are generally preferred..
